Family Connects leaves an impact in North Carolina Counties

Family Connects, formerly Durham Connects, is the first home visiting model used for entire community. Results already show the positive impact of the program in Durham and the model has expanded to other communities such as Forsyth and Guilford Counties. Family Connects works by assigning a nurse to a family.  

This nurse will then visit with newborn parents, check the infant’s physical well-being, and ensure how the family is coping with the social and fiscal aspects of being a new parent. Through home visits, nurses assess the needs of parents and link parents who need assistance with community resources. Examples of community resources nurses connect families to include parenting classes, breastfeeding assistance, and assistance finding childcare.
